Abstract

The title compound 2-((Pyridin-4-yl)methyl)isoindoline-1,3-dione was synthesized and characterized by NMR, DSC, DTA, TGA, UV-vis-NIR spectroscopic techniques and finally the structure was confirmed by the single crystal X-ray diffraction method. The compound crystallizes in the triclinic crystal system with the space group P-1. The structure exhibits both inter and intra-molecular hydrogen bonds of the type C-H…O which stabilize the molecular and crystal structure of the title compound. Further, the Hirshfeld surface analysis for visually analyzing intermolecular interactions in crystal structures employing molecular surface contours and 2D fingerprint plots have been used to examine percentage contribution from an each individual intermolecular interactions to the surface. The H-H (37.5%), O-H (19.5%) and C-H (17.8%) interactions are the major contributors to the Hirshfeld surface. The molecular structure also involves C-O…Cg and Cg-Cg interactions. The title compound has a good transparency in UV, visible and NIR region which makes it suitable for NLO applications.
